Responsibilities

  • Develop and maintain stored procedures, triggers, and other database objects
  • Participate in the development of reports and integration with other systems
  • Perform database testing and debugging
  • Participate in code reviews
  • Document database design, architecture, and processes
  • Implement and maintain database security measures
  • Ensure data security, data integrity, and data quality
  • Monitor database performance and resolve issues as necessary
  • Transition efficiently between various tasks such as high priority requests and ongoing projects
  • Collaborate with other developers, stakeholders, and end-users to understand requirements and provide solutions that meet business needs
  • Architect, develop, and manage scalable, reliable data pipelines
Requirements
  • A BS in Computer Science or equivalent experience
  • 2-4 years designing, developing, and maintaining a database
  • Proficiency in MSSQL (T-SQL, Stored Procs) or equivalent
  • Working knowledge of at least one database management system (e.g., Oracle, MySQL, Microsoft SQL Server)
  • Familiarity with database design principles and techniques, including data modeling and normalization
  • Understanding of database performance tuning techniques, including indexing and query optimization
  • Prior knowledge of ETL concepts and processes, including data transformation and data loading. Some experience with at least one ETL tool a plus
  • Flexible working in a variety of IDEs such as Visual Studio, Snowflake, and others
  • Exposure to visualization tools such as DOMO, Power BI, and Tableau is desirable, with DOMO experience preferred
  • Experience with SSIS, SSRS, and SSAS is a plus
  • Knowledge of programming languages such as Python is a plus
  • Awareness of laws surrounding data and data privacy
  • Strong problem‑solving skills and attention to detail
  • Strong work ethic and willingness to learn
  • Good communication and collaboration
